What it does
VCV is a homework verification system: record your lectures, divide them into modules and lessons, and send them to your students in the convenient form of a landing page. Complement the learning process with questions in text or video format and receive feedback or homework in a corresponding manner. Video answers are the best way to assess your students' knowledge in the area of humanities or social sciences. This platform allows for an easy way to manage homework submissions, midterm and final exams. VCV easily fits other tools for online learning: video conferences in Skype and Zoom, teacher-student communication in Microsoft Teams, and others. Conduct a lecture or seminar via video conference, and after checking student knowledge with the help of our video interviews and tests, collect all the information regarding project materials and save each student's performance result on your VCV account.

What I learned
It's possible to launch the new way of product usage within 1 week but it requires a lot of explanatory materials and account management. We were fast enough and this helped us to acquire the first 20 educational institutions very fast. And we're constantly learning from their experience and feedbacks, improving the platform so that it could suit educational purposes even more.
What's next for VCV for education
Integration with Microsoft Teams for video conferencing for more than 5 people. Integration with calendars for scheduling online classes.
